James Farrell, D.C.

Chiropractic Physician

Dr. Farrell received his BA in Biology from Rutgers-Camden University in 1998.   Then attended the University of Bridgeport in Connecticut, earning his Doctor of Chiropractic degree in 2002.

Dr. Farrell has had extensive training and experience in all forms of Manual Therapy.  Manual therapy is the use of hands-on techniques to evaluate, treat, and improve the status of neuromusculoskeletal conditions.  In conjuction with chiropractic manipulative adjusments, these techniques are very effective in helping patients return to full strength following injury.

Keeping patients in an active lifestyle is important to Dr. Farrell, from novice to the professional level.  He has competed in numerous 5K's, and sprint triathlons. Also completing the Eagleman 70.3 Ironman race in 2010, and the Marine Corp Marathon in both 2009, and 2011.



Maisie Hahn, D.C., CCSP

Chiropractic Physician

Dr. Maisie Hahn graduated from University of Western Ontario in London, Ontario, Canada with a Bachelor of Science degree.

 

She then attended and graduated from New York Chiropractic College in the year 2002 Sigma Cum Laude and began practicing in the Cape May County Area. Since beginning practice Dr. Hahn has earned her CCSP (Certified Chiropractic Sports Physician) certification and her CFT (Certified Personal Training Certification) from the ISSA. Her professional associations include: ISSA, ANJC, ANJC Sports Council and the ACBSP.

 

Dr. Hahn has had much success in treating patients ranging from infants to the elderly and treats many conditions, including: sports injuries, headaches, acute and chronic spinal injuries and complaints, carpal tunnel syndrome, plantar fascitis, tendonitis, pregnancy related complaints and many more.

Massage is one of the oldest, simplest forms of therapy.
The basic goal of massage therapy is to help the body heal itself and to increase health and well-being. There are many health benefits to receiving massage therapy on a regular basis:

Relieves stress ~ ​Encourages relaxation ~ Improves posture ~ Lowers blood pressure​ ~ Relaxes muscles ~ Improves flexibility ~ Relieves tension headaches ~ Helps manage pain
